免费看操逼电影1_99r这里只有精品12_久久久.n_日本护士高潮小说_无码良品_av在线1…_国产精品亚洲系列久久_色檀色AV导航_操逼操 亚洲_看在线黄色AV_A级无码乱伦黑料专区国产_高清极品嫩模喷水a片_超碰18禁_监国产盗摄视频在线观看_国产淑女操逼网站

現(xiàn)代應(yīng)用架構(gòu)實(shí)踐:打造高擴(kuò)展性的App后端框架。

??現(xiàn)代應(yīng)用架構(gòu)實(shí)踐:打造高擴(kuò)展性的App后端框架??

在移動(dòng)互聯(lián)網(wǎng)爆發(fā)式增長(zhǎng)的2025年,用戶對(duì)App的響應(yīng)速度、穩(wěn)定性和個(gè)性化功能的要求越來(lái)越高。??后端框架的擴(kuò)展性??直接決定了應(yīng)用能否快速適應(yīng)業(yè)務(wù)增長(zhǎng)、突發(fā)流量或技術(shù)迭代。但現(xiàn)實(shí)中,許多團(tuán)隊(duì)仍面臨架構(gòu)僵化、資源浪費(fèi)和運(yùn)維成本飆升的困境——如何破局?


??為什么擴(kuò)展性成為后端架構(gòu)的核心挑戰(zhàn)???

當(dāng)用戶量從1萬(wàn)驟增至1000萬(wàn)時(shí),系統(tǒng)崩潰的根源往往不是代碼質(zhì)量,而是架構(gòu)設(shè)計(jì)。例如,某社交App在2025年初因明星入駐導(dǎo)致流量暴漲,但??單體架構(gòu)??的數(shù)據(jù)庫(kù)鎖教讓服務(wù)癱瘓了3小時(shí)。這暴露了傳統(tǒng)架構(gòu)的致命缺陷:

  • ??垂直擴(kuò)展天花板??:?jiǎn)渭冊(cè)黾臃?wù)器配置無(wú)法解決高并發(fā)問(wèn)題,成本呈指數(shù)級(jí)上升
  • ??技術(shù)債堆積??:緊耦合的代碼使得新增功能需重構(gòu)核心邏輯,迭代周期延長(zhǎng)60%以上
  • ??資源利用率低下??:固定規(guī)格的服務(wù)器在流量低谷時(shí)閑置率超70%

??解決方案?將擴(kuò)展性設(shè)計(jì)前置到架構(gòu)階段??,而非事后補(bǔ)救。


??微服務(wù)化:拆分與治理的藝術(shù)??

微服務(wù)并非銀彈,但合理拆分能實(shí)現(xiàn)??業(yè)務(wù)級(jí)彈性擴(kuò)展??。以電商平臺(tái)為例:

  1. ??按領(lǐng)域拆分服務(wù)??

    • 用戶服務(wù)、訂單服務(wù)、支付服務(wù)獨(dú)立部署,避免單點(diǎn)故障擴(kuò)散
    • 使用??Kubernetes??自動(dòng)擴(kuò)縮容,訂單服務(wù)在促銷(xiāo)期間可快速擴(kuò)容至20個(gè)實(shí)例
  2. ??通信機(jī)制優(yōu)化??

    • 同步調(diào)用改用??gRPC??(高頻交易)或??REST??(低頻管理接口)
    • 異步消息隊(duì)列(如Kafka)處理日志、庫(kù)存更新等非實(shí)時(shí)任務(wù)
  3. ??關(guān)鍵工具對(duì)比??

場(chǎng)景技術(shù)選型擴(kuò)展性優(yōu)勢(shì)
服務(wù)發(fā)現(xiàn)Consul多數(shù)據(jù)中心支持,動(dòng)態(tài)節(jié)點(diǎn)注冊(cè)
鏈路追蹤Jaeger分布式事務(wù)性能可視化
限流熔斷Sentinel秒級(jí)響應(yīng)流量激增

??數(shù)據(jù)層擴(kuò)展:從數(shù)據(jù)庫(kù)到緩存策略??

數(shù)據(jù)庫(kù)往往是擴(kuò)展的最后一道瓶頸。某短視頻App在2025年通過(guò)??分層存儲(chǔ)??將查詢延遲降低80%:

  • ??熱數(shù)據(jù)??:Redis集群緩存點(diǎn)贊、評(píng)論等高頻操作,TPS可達(dá)10萬(wàn)+
  • ??溫?cái)?shù)據(jù)??:MySQL分庫(kù)分表(用戶ID哈希),配合??Vitess??自動(dòng)化分片
  • ??冷數(shù)據(jù)??:TiDB歸檔歷史數(shù)據(jù),壓縮存儲(chǔ)成本下降65%

??特別注意??:

  • 避免“緩存穿透”用??布隆過(guò)濾器??攔截?zé)o效請(qǐng)求
  • 分布式事務(wù)用??Saga模式??替代兩階段提交,吞吐量提升5倍

??DevOps與可觀測(cè)性:擴(kuò)展性的隱形支柱??

架構(gòu)擴(kuò)展后,運(yùn)維復(fù)雜度可能抵消技術(shù)收益。建議:

  1. ??基礎(chǔ)設(shè)施即代碼(IaC)??

    • Terraform定義AWS/GCP資源,5分鐘復(fù)刻一套測(cè)試環(huán)境
    • Ansible標(biāo)準(zhǔn)化中間件配置,避免“雪花服務(wù)器”
  2. ??全鏈路監(jiān)控??

    • Prometheus+Granfana實(shí)時(shí)跟蹤C(jī)PU/內(nèi)存,預(yù)測(cè)擴(kuò)容閾值
    • 日志中心化(ELK Stack)關(guān)聯(lián)分析微服務(wù)異常
  3. ??混沌工程實(shí)踐??

    • 每月模擬網(wǎng)絡(luò)分區(qū)、節(jié)點(diǎn)宕機(jī),暴露架構(gòu)脆弱點(diǎn)

??未來(lái)趨勢(shì):Serverless與邊緣計(jì)算??

2025年,??函數(shù)計(jì)算(FaaS)??正在改寫(xiě)擴(kuò)展性規(guī)則:

  • 自動(dòng)擴(kuò)縮至零:無(wú)請(qǐng)求時(shí)不產(chǎn)生費(fèi)用,成本節(jié)省40%+
  • 邊緣節(jié)點(diǎn)處理CDN附近的計(jì)算(如用戶地理位置解析),延遲<50ms

但需權(quán)衡冷啟動(dòng)延遲,關(guān)鍵業(yè)務(wù)仍建議保留常駐容器。

??獨(dú)家數(shù)據(jù)??:據(jù)Forrester調(diào)研,采用混合架構(gòu)(微服務(wù)+Serverless)的企業(yè),其功能上線速度比傳統(tǒng)模式快3倍,且運(yùn)維人力減少50%。


??最后思考??:高擴(kuò)展性不是技術(shù)堆砌,而是??以終為始的設(shè)計(jì)思維??。從第一天起,就要假設(shè)你的App會(huì)服務(wù)1億用戶——這才是現(xiàn)代架構(gòu)師的終極測(cè)試。


本文原地址:http://m.czyjwy.com/news/177283.html
本站文章均來(lái)自互聯(lián)網(wǎng),僅供學(xué)習(xí)參考,如有侵犯您的版權(quán),請(qǐng)郵箱聯(lián)系我們刪除!
上一篇:現(xiàn)貨app開(kāi)發(fā)
下一篇:現(xiàn)代移動(dòng)應(yīng)用開(kāi)發(fā)中的關(guān)鍵數(shù)據(jù)安全風(fēng)險(xiǎn)與高效防范策略分析